iClipLyrics 1.4.0

file size: 1.28 MB

iClip Lyrics is an easy to use iTunes Tool that searches for the lyrics of playing track and adds it in the TagID3.

If the lyrics has not been found you can start a Google Search, select the lyrics and paste it in the current song with a click! iClip Lyrics allows you easly edit the lyrics and save changes with a few click. You can also keep iClip Lyrics forward other application to display the lyrics always on top.

Note

Mac OS X 10.5 or higher. iTunes 7.4 or higher.
